Output 1c3b76c8ef84fb5330085be87e358eb9f95331b576ba2c56aa7c9bd263023170:20

value
70000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d2147a0b14d1434cf27f05a8edb989ea77fa3e9 OP_EQUAL
address
3LPeKBxX8Ln2DXeYcUNdt8juBfXEWUkLUa
transaction
1c3b76c8ef84fb5330085be87e358eb9f95331b576ba2c56aa7c9bd263023170
spent
true